Change the paths and index nr's (home(sl) or cloud) according to your scenario and copy all the lines below and paste them in the DISM CMD (the one installed by the ADK): Code: dism.exe /Mount-WIM /WimFile:"x:\install.wim" /index:1 /MountDir:"y:\mount" dism.exe /image:y:\mount /Get-CurrentEdition dism.exe /image:y:\mount /Get-TargetEditions dism.exe /image:"y:\mount" /Set-Edition:ProfessionalWorkstation dism.exe /Unmount-wim /mountdir:"y:\mount" /commit imagex /flags "ProfessionalWorkstation" /info "x:\install.wim" 1 "Win 10 IP Pro-Workstation xx-XX (16257.1)" "Win 10 IP Pro-Workstation xx-XX (16257.1)" And all will be done for you
